Papers of Frank Dyson

Title Papers on Jupiter's eighth satellite
Reference RGO 8/168
Covering Dates 1917–1924
Extent and Medium 1 bundle
Content and context

Correspondence with John Jackson of the Royal Observatory of 1922-1924, published material and other papers regarding the eighth satellite of Jupiter, including the satellite's orbit and osculating elements. There are also tables of the computation of the standard coordinates of J. VIII observed with the 30-inch reflector of the Thompson Equatorial on 7 November 1917, 5 December 1917 and 7 and 11 January 1918.
